The inaugaral FIBA 3x3 All Stars event is due to get underway in Doha, Qatar tomorrow ©FIBADecember 11 - The International Basketball Federation's (FIBA) 3x3 All Stars event will get underway in Doha tomorrow as the number one players from across the world prepare to battle for basketball supremacy on the Katara Beach.


The highest ranked player from Europe, the Americas, the Rest of the World, which consists of Africa, Asia, and the Pacific, the host nation - Qatar - will play with their respective teams for a share of the $120,000 (£72,000/€91,000) prize pot.

A legends team will make up the final team in the field.

World number one 3x3 player, Dusan Domovic Bulut, will lead his Serbian team Nova Sad as the representatives from Europe.

Ranking points earned from winning the FIBA 3x3 World Tour Prague Masters and finishing runners-up in the Istanbul final have helped the Serbian climb to the top of the individual world rankings and book his and his teams place in this All Star event.

"It was a long and hard job," Balut admitted today.

"We played a lot of tournaments all around the world this year and this is what brought us here."

Venezuelan Michaell Flores secured Team Caracus' place in the event as the number one ranked player in the Americas, with Rest of the World number one Tomoya Ochiai ensuring Japan's Team Nagoya gained a spot.

3x3 basketball has gained enormous popularity since its worldwide competitive debut at the 2010 Youth Olympics in Singapore ©Getty Images3x3 basketball has gained enormous popularity since its worldwide competitive debut at the 2010 Youth Olympics in Singapore ©Getty Images



Winners of the World Tour, Team Brezovica of Slovakia, will be looking to add to a superb season with victory in Qatar.

They qualify on the back of Blaz Cresnar's world number two spot; although a strong outfit sees their other three members make up the top five behind Cresnar and Bulut.

The hosts will be without their number one player Boney Watson who was forced to withdraw from the squad with a knee injury last week.

The team proved confident enough without him as Team Doha beat the sixth and final team of the competition FC Barcelona in an exhibition game on Wednesday.

The FC Barcelona side is made up of former legends from the team, including Manel Bosch, Rodrigo De La Fuente, Roger Esteller and Ferran Martinez.

The action starts  at 15:00 local time with the first game featuring Brezovica against Nagoya on Katara Beach.
